How to Check a Dogecoin Block231


Dogecoin is a decentralized, peer-to-peer digital currency that was created as a joke in 2013. Despite its humble beginnings, Dogecoin has gained a loyal following and has become one of the most popular cryptocurrencies in the world. One of the key features of Dogecoin is its blockchain, which is a public ledger of all Dogecoin transactions. The blockchain is an immutable record of all transactions that have ever been made on the Dogecoin network, and it can be used to track the movement of Dogecoin from one address to another.

There are a few different ways to check a Dogecoin block. One way is to use a block explorer. A block explorer is a website or service that allows you to search the Dogecoin blockchain and view information about individual blocks. Some popular block explorers include Dogecoinchain and Blockchair.

To use a block explorer, simply enter the block number or hash into the search bar. The block explorer will then display information about the block, including the block height, the timestamp, the number of transactions in the block, and the total amount of Dogecoin that was mined in the block. You can also click on the links to view the individual transactions in the block.

Another way to check a Dogecoin block is to use the Dogecoin Core wallet. The Dogecoin Core wallet is a full-node wallet that allows you to interact with the Dogecoin blockchain directly. To check a block in the Dogecoin Core wallet, open the wallet and click on the "Debug window" tab. Then, click on the "Console" tab and enter the following command:```
getblock
```

The Dogecoin Core wallet will then display information about the block, including the block height, the timestamp, the number of transactions in the block, and the total amount of Dogecoin that was mined in the block. Checking a Dogecoin block can be useful for a variety of reasons. For example, you can use a block explorer to track the movement of your own Dogecoin transactions. You can also use a block explorer to research the Dogecoin blockchain and learn more about how it works. Finally, you can use the Dogecoin Core wallet to check a block if you are experiencing any issues with your wallet or the Dogecoin network.
